A polynomial in standard form is a polynomial written such that its exponents are in descending order. The standard form of a polynomial with degree n is given by a n x n + a n − 1 x n − 1 + . . . + a 1 x + a 0 ( Note: The first term of a polynomial in standard form, the term containing the highest degree, is called the leading term.)

To write a polynomial in standard form, you must do the following steps: Add (or subtract) the like terms of the polynomial. Write the term with the highest degree first. Write all the other terms in decreasing order of degree. Remember that a term with a variable but without an exponent is of degree 1.

Solution: The first term is the one with the biggest power: \ (8+5x^2−3x^3=−3x^3+5x^2+8\) Writing Polynomials in Standard Form - Example 2: Write this polynomial in standard form. \ (5x^2−9x^5+8x^3−11= \) Solution: The first term is the one with the biggest power: \ (5x^2−9x^5+8x^3−11= −9x^5+8x^3+5x^2−11 \)

A polynomial is an expression made with constants, variables, and positive integer exponents of the variables. An example of a polynomial is: 4x3 + 2x2 − 3x + 1. There are four terms: 4x3, 2x2, − 3x, and 1.

The "Standard Form" for writing down a polynomial is to put the terms with the highest degree first (like the "2" in x 2 if there is one variable). Example: Put this in Standard Form: 3 x2 − 7 + 4 x3 + x6 The highest degree is 6, so that goes first, then 3, 2 and then the constant last: x6 + 4 x3 + 3 x2 − 7 Standard Form of a Linear Equation
